They may be at the bottom of the Premier League but Watford FC is now accepting bitcoin

The popular English league football team has found a new sponsor in Sportsbet.io who will have its logo on the Watford players sleeve for the foreseeable future.

According to the DailyMail, the logo for bitcoin will also be on the sleeves for the upcoming match this weekend at home against Arsenal.

This alone is great news for the crypto space but that isn’t the only round of bullish news…

Other Premier League teams such as Tottenham Hotspur, Leicester City, Newcastle United, Southampton, Cardiff City, Brighton and Crystal Palace have all agreed to set up digital wallets with an online trading platform which states it doesn’t have any doubts that cryptocurrency will eventually replace the British sterling in the multi-billion pound transfer industry.

According to the popular eToro trading platform (which has paid football clubs to get involved with the movement), the aforementioned bitcoin system will also help clubs fight ticket touting and knock-off merchandise.

The rise in the price of cryptocurrencies has been often accompanied by an increase of general interest by big institutional investors, or in this case one of the biggest football leagues in the world. At the end of 2017, we saw a lot more people enter the market who probably never even heard of cryptocurrency or blockchain and get involved with the space. 

This isn’t the first time football has involved with crypto and blockchain though.

Earlier this year, the CEO of TRON Justin Sun received what looked like an invitation from Liverpool Football Club. However, TRON was just one of these platforms/firms and Liverpool quickly came out to say that they don’t plan on collaborating with TRON at all!
